Liquid Holdings Wins 2014 HFM Award
Awarded Best Risk Management Provider From Pool of Market-Recognized Service Providers

On Thursday, October 23, 2014 we were awarded the 2014 HFM Award for the Best Risk Management Provider for hedge funds and other alternative investment managers. HFM announced the winners at a luncheon award ceremony in New York City, recognizing hedge fund service providers that have demonstrated innovative product development over the past twelve months.

Our flagship product, the Liquid platform, is a smarter, simpler solution for fund managers - freeing up their time to manage investments by eliminating non-integrated workflows and infrastructure as well as other time-consuming processes. Liquid is a front-office operating system, powered by a proprietary cloud, and backed by managed services. Moving to Liquid helps managers drive better insights into real-time trading activity and portfolio performance while institutionalizing the business with secure, repeatable processes across disaster recovery, business continuity, and broker reconciliations.

This is our third award for 'Best Risk Management Provider' in 2014 -- earlier this year, Liquid Holdings was awarded the Best U.S. and Global Provider of Risk Technology by Hedgeweek's readership.
